// MARK: - DataStack
/**
The `DataStack` encapsulates the data model for the Core Data stack. Each `DataStack` can have multiple data stores, usually specified as a "Configuration" in the model editor. Behind the scenes, the DataStack manages its own `NSPersistentStoreCoordinator`, a root `NSManagedObjectContext` for disk saves, and a shared `NSManagedObjectContext` designed as a read-only model interface for `NSManagedObjects`.
*/
public final class DataStack {
// MARK: Public
/**
Initializes a `DataStack` from a model created by merging all the models found in all bundles.
*/
public convenience init() {
let mergedModel: NSManagedObjectModel! = NSManagedObjectModel.mergedModelFromBundles(NSBundle.allBundles())
CoreStore.assert(mergedModel != nil, "Could not create a merged <\(NSManagedObjectModel.self)> from all bundles.")
self.init(managedObjectModel: mergedModel)
}
/**
Initializes a `DataStack` from the specified model name.
:param: modelName the name of the (.xcdatamodeld) model file.
*/
public convenience init(modelName: String) {
let modelFilePath: String! = NSBundle.mainBundle().pathForResource(modelName, ofType: "momd")
CoreStore.assert(modelFilePath != nil, "Could not find a \"momd\" resource from the main bundle.")
let managedObjectModel: NSManagedObjectModel! = NSManagedObjectModel(contentsOfURL: NSURL(fileURLWithPath: modelFilePath)!)
CoreStore.assert(managedObjectModel != nil, "Could not create an <\(NSManagedObjectModel.self)> from the resource at path \"\(modelFilePath)\".")
self.init(managedObjectModel: managedObjectModel)
}
/**
Initializes a `DataStack` from an `NSManagedObjectModel`.
:param: managedObjectModel the `NSManagedObjectModel` of the (.xcdatamodeld) model file.
*/
public required init(managedObjectModel: NSManagedObjectModel) {
self.coordinator = NSPersistentStoreCoordinator(managedObjectModel: managedObjectModel)
self.rootSavingContext = NSManagedObjectContext.rootSavingContextForCoordinator(self.coordinator)
self.mainContext = NSManagedObjectContext.mainContextForRootContext(self.rootSavingContext)
var entityNameMapping = [EntityClassNameType: EntityNameType]()
var entityConfigurationsMapping = [EntityClassNameType: Set<String>]()
for entityDescription in managedObjectModel.entities as! [NSEntityDescription] {
let managedObjectClassName = entityDescription.managedObjectClassName
entityConfigurationsMapping[managedObjectClassName] = []
if let entityName = entityDescription.name {
entityNameMapping[managedObjectClassName] = entityName
}
}
self.entityNameMapping = entityNameMapping
self.entityConfigurationsMapping = entityConfigurationsMapping
self.rootSavingContext.parentStack = self
}
/**
Adds an in-memory store to the stack.
:param: configuration an optional configuration name from the model file. If not specified, defaults to nil.
:returns: a `PersistentStoreResult` indicating success or failure.
*/
public func addInMemoryStore(configuration: String? = nil) -> PersistentStoreResult {
let coordinator = self.coordinator;
var error: NSError?
var store: NSPersistentStore?
coordinator.performBlockAndWait {
store = coordinator.addPersistentStoreWithType(
NSInMemoryStoreType,
configuration: configuration,
URL: nil,
options: nil,
error: &error)
}
if let store = store {
self.updateMetadataForPersistentStore(store)
return PersistentStoreResult(store)
}
if let error = error {
CoreStore.handleError(
error,
"Failed to add in-memory <\(NSPersistentStore.self)>.")
return PersistentStoreResult(error)
}
else {
CoreStore.handleError(
NSError(coreStoreErrorCode: .UnknownError),
"Failed to add in-memory <\(NSPersistentStore.self)>.")
return PersistentStoreResult(.UnknownError)
}
}
/**
Adds to the stack an SQLite store from the given SQLite file name.
:param: fileName the local filename for the SQLite persistent store in the "Application Support" directory. A new SQLite file will be created if it does not exist. Note that if you have multiple configurations, you will need to specify a different `fileName` explicitly for each of them.
:param: configuration an optional configuration name from the model file. If not specified, defaults to `nil`, the "Default" configuration. Note that if you have multiple configurations, you will need to specify a different `fileName` explicitly for each of them.
:param: automigrating Set to true to configure Core Data auto-migration, or false to disable. If not specified, defaults to true.
:param: resetStoreOnMigrationFailure Set to true to delete the store on migration failure; or set to false to throw exceptions on failure instead. Typically should only be set to true when debugging, or if the persistent store can be recreated easily. If not specified, defaults to false
:returns: a `PersistentStoreResult` indicating success or failure.
*/
public func addSQLiteStore(fileName: String, configuration: String? = nil, automigrating: Bool = true, resetStoreOnMigrationFailure: Bool = false) -> PersistentStoreResult {
return self.addSQLiteStore(
fileURL: applicationSupportDirectory.URLByAppendingPathComponent(
fileName,
isDirectory: false
),
configuration: configuration,
automigrating: automigrating,
resetStoreOnMigrationFailure: resetStoreOnMigrationFailure
)
}
/**
Adds to the stack an SQLite store from the given SQLite file URL.
:param: fileURL the local file URL for the SQLite persistent store. A new SQLite file will be created if it does not exist. If not specified, defaults to a file URL pointing to a "<Application name>.sqlite" file in the "Application Support" directory. Note that if you have multiple configurations, you will need to specify a different `fileURL` explicitly for each of them.
:param: configuration an optional configuration name from the model file. If not specified, defaults to `nil`, the "Default" configuration. Note that if you have multiple configurations, you will need to specify a different `fileURL` explicitly for each of them.
:param: automigrating Set to true to configure Core Data auto-migration, or false to disable. If not specified, defaults to true.
:param: resetStoreOnMigrationFailure Set to true to delete the store on migration failure; or set to false to throw exceptions on failure instead. Typically should only be set to true when debugging, or if the persistent store can be recreated easily. If not specified, defaults to false.
:returns: a `PersistentStoreResult` indicating success or failure.
*/
public func addSQLiteStore(fileURL: NSURL = defaultSQLiteStoreURL, configuration: String? = nil, automigrating: Bool = true, resetStoreOnMigrationFailure: Bool = false) -> PersistentStoreResult {
let coordinator = self.coordinator;
if let store = coordinator.persistentStoreForURL(fileURL) {
let isExistingStoreAutomigrating = ((store.options?[NSMigratePersistentStoresAutomaticallyOption] as? Bool) ?? false)
if store.type == NSSQLiteStoreType
&& isExistingStoreAutomigrating == automigrating
&& store.configurationName == (configuration ?? Into.defaultConfigurationName) {
return PersistentStoreResult(store)
}
CoreStore.handleError(
NSError(coreStoreErrorCode: .DifferentPersistentStoreExistsAtURL),
"Failed to add SQLite <\(NSPersistentStore.self)> at \"\(fileURL)\" because a different <\(NSPersistentStore.self)> at that URL already exists.")
return PersistentStoreResult(.DifferentPersistentStoreExistsAtURL)
}
let fileManager = NSFileManager.defaultManager()
var directoryError: NSError?
if !fileManager.createDirectoryAtURL(
fileURL.URLByDeletingLastPathComponent!,
withIntermediateDirectories: true,
attributes: nil,
error: &directoryError) {
CoreStore.handleError(
directoryError ?? NSError(coreStoreErrorCode: .UnknownError),
"Failed to create directory for SQLite store at \"\(fileURL)\".")
return PersistentStoreResult(directoryError!)
}
var store: NSPersistentStore?
var persistentStoreError: NSError?
coordinator.performBlockAndWait {
store = coordinator.addPersistentStoreWithType(
NSSQLiteStoreType,
configuration: configuration,
URL: fileURL,
options: [NSSQLitePragmasOption: ["WAL": "journal_mode"],
NSInferMappingModelAutomaticallyOption: true,
NSMigratePersistentStoresAutomaticallyOption: automigrating],
error: &persistentStoreError)
}
if let store = store {
self.updateMetadataForPersistentStore(store)
return PersistentStoreResult(store)
}
if let error = persistentStoreError
where (
resetStoreOnMigrationFailure
&& (error.code == NSPersistentStoreIncompatibleVersionHashError
|| error.code == NSMigrationMissingSourceModelError
|| error.code == NSMigrationError)
&& error.domain == NSCocoaErrorDomain
) {
fileManager.removeItemAtURL(fileURL, error: nil)
fileManager.removeItemAtPath(
fileURL.path!.stringByAppendingString("-shm"),
error: nil)
fileManager.removeItemAtPath(
fileURL.path!.stringByAppendingString("-wal"),
error: nil)
var store: NSPersistentStore?
coordinator.performBlockAndWait {
store = coordinator.addPersistentStoreWithType(
NSSQLiteStoreType,
configuration: configuration,
URL: fileURL,
options: [NSSQLitePragmasOption: ["WAL": "journal_mode"],
NSInferMappingModelAutomaticallyOption: true,
NSMigratePersistentStoresAutomaticallyOption: automigrating],
error: &persistentStoreError)
}
if let store = store {
self.updateMetadataForPersistentStore(store)
return PersistentStoreResult(store)
}
}
CoreStore.handleError(
persistentStoreError ?? NSError(coreStoreErrorCode: .UnknownError),
"Failed to add SQLite <\(NSPersistentStore.self)> at \"\(fileURL)\".")
return PersistentStoreResult(.UnknownError)
}
